Forcing S4 to do a “MIDI Send-State”? (i.e. sync Traktor w/ S4 knob positions)
Hello all,
I’ve been spending a lot more time ‘spinning records’ (yep, I still call it that) since I picked up an S4, and I’ve almost finished my ground-up MIDI mapping. One of the problems that just irks me is that every time I boot up Traktor, the states of the controls on my S4 don’t match the one’s on-screen until I move them for the first time. I’ve trained myself to go through a (painstaking) process of systematically moving each of my controls to prevent Traktor from thinking a volume slider is UP when the S4’s slider is actually down.
I know a lot of MIDI devices have the ability to do a ‘send-state’ - sending the CC/note/etc for each of the controls at its current physical position. Anyone know if the S4 has this feature hidden away somewhere? Maybe this is a standard MIDI command I’m unaware of? (I haven’t dealt with the SYSEX side of MIDI at all, so forgive me if I missed the obvious)
